Always use a factory approved
shackle and strap when attach-
ing the hook to an anchor point.
Always before winching a load,
be sure the freespool is fully in
the engaged position.
• Never exceed the winch rated
capacity.
Never use a winch to secure a
load in place. Secure load and
detach hook from load when
transporting the load.
• Always be certain anchor will
withstand the load.
• Always keep helpers and
spectators at a safe distance.
• Never let the rope slip through
your hands, even with gloves on.
• Never touch the rope or hook
while they are in tension, under
load, or when someone else is
at the control switch.
• Always use factory approved
switches, controls accessories
and components.
• Always assure that the equip-
ment such as tackle, hooks
Pulley blocks, straps, etc. are
rated in excess of the load
capability of the winch.
•Always inspect equipment for
wear or damage prior to use:
immediately replace worn or
damaged equipment.
